📚 Historical Context
This appears in the Chronicles' genealogical record that traces human lineage from Adam forward. Abraham lived around 2000 BC and had Isaac with his wife Sarah, and Ishmael with Sarah's servant Hagar. Both sons became fathers of great nations - Isaac's descendants became the Israelites, while Ishmael's became various Arab tribes.
